Jazz pianist-composer Andrew Hill dies

Jazzman Andrew Hill, a groundbreaking pianist and composer known for his complex post-bop style, died early Friday, his record label announced. He was 75. Hill, who had been diagnosed with lung cancer three years ago, died at his Jersey City, N.J., home, according to Cem Kurosman of Blue Note Records. He had released his final album, "Time Lines," in early 2006, a farewell that earned him album of the year honors from Down Beat magazine
